Does anyone know where I can find illustrations or photographs of camel,
dugong and gazelle(any species) skeletons and bones?
Hi Karen
Here are some references for gazelles and dugongs. Some for skeletons,
some for teeth and horn cores (gazelles). Hope this can help!
Helene
_
For gazella_ :
Helmer, D. and Rocheteau, M. (1994). Atlas du squelette appendiculaire
des principaux genres holocènes de petits ruminants du nord de la
Méditerranée et du Proche-Orient (Capra, Ovis, Rupicapra, Capreolus,
Gazella). Juan-les-Pins, Centre de recherches Archéologiques du CNRS.
Peters, J. (1986). Osteomorphology and osteometry of the appendicular
skeleton of Grant's gazelle, Gazella granti Brooke, 1872, bohor
reedbuck, Redunca redunca (Pallas, 1767) and bushbuck, Tragelaphus
scriptus (Pallas, 1766). Occasional Papers, laboratorium voor
Paleontologie, Rijksuniversiteit Gent: 1-65.
or
Peters, J. (1989). Osteomorphological features of the appendicular
skeleton of Gazelles, genus Gazella Blainville 1816, Bohor Reedbuck,
Redunca redunca (Pallas, 1767) and Bushbuck, Tragelaphus scriptus
(Pallas, 1766). Anat. Histol. Embryol. 18: 97-113.
Gentry, A. W. (1964). Skull characters of african gazelles. Annals and
Magazines of natural History(s. 13): 353-382.
Groves, C. P. (1975). Notes on the gazelles. 1. Gazella rufifrons and
the zoogeography of central african Bovidae. Zeitschrift für
Säugetierkunde 40: 308-319.
Groves, C. P. (1981). Notes on the gazelles. 3. The Dorcas gazelles of
North Africa. Ann. Mus. Civ. Stor. nat. Genova: 455-471.
_For dugongs_ :
James, P. S. B. R. (1974). An osteological study of the Dugong, Dugong
dugon (Sirenia) from India. Marine Biology 27: 173-184.
Kaiser, H. E. (1974). Morphology of the Sirenia : a macroscopic and
X-Ray atlas of the osteology of recent species. S. Karger.
Mitchell, J. (1973). Determination of relative age in the dugong, Dugong
dugon (Müller) from a study of skull and teeth. Zoological Journal of
the Linnean Society 53: 1-23.
Mitchell, J. (1976). Age determination in the dugong, Dugong dugon
(Müller). Biological Conservation 9: 25-28.
Petit, G. (1928). Les vertèbres cervicales des Siréniens
actuels.Archives du Muséum d'Histoire Naturelle 6è série: 243-299.
_Fossils dugongs from United Arab Emirates_ (I can send a pdf):
Jousse, H. and Guérin, C. (2003). Les dugongs (Sirenia, Dugongidae) de
l'Holocène ancien d'Umm al-Qaiwain (Emirats Arabes Unis). Mammalia
67(3): 337-347.
